Land Compensation Act 1973E+W

7.—(1) The Land Compensation Act 1973(1) is amended as follows.

(2) In section 29(2) (right to home loss payment where person displaced from dwelling)—

(a)in subsection (1)—

(i)after paragraph (e), insert—

(f)the making of an order for possession of a dwelling subject to a tenancy which is a secure contract on ground A or ground B of the Estate Management Grounds in Part 1 of Schedule 8 to the Renting Homes (Wales) Act 2016 (anaw 1),;

(ii)in paragraph (v), after “paragraph (e)”, insert “or (f)”;

(b)in subsection (4)—

(i)at the end of paragraph (e)(iii), omit “or”;

(ii)after paragraph (e)(iv), insert—

(v)the licence is a secure contract, or

(vi)the licence is an introductory standard contract.

(3) In section 32(3) (supplementary provisions about home loss payments), after subsection (7B), insert—

(7C) Where a landlord obtains possession by agreement of a dwelling in Wales subject to a tenancy which is a secure contract and—

(a)notice of proceedings for possession of the dwelling has been served, or might have been served, specifying ground A or ground B of the estate management grounds in Part 1 of Schedule 8 to the Renting Homes (Wales) Act 2016 (anaw 1), or

(b)the landlord has applied, or could apply, to the Welsh Ministers for approval for the purposes of estate management ground B of a scheme for the disposal and redevelopment of an area of land consisting of or including the whole or part of the dwelling,

the landlord may make to any person giving up possession or occupation a payment corresponding to any home loss payment or discretionary payment which they would be required or authorised to make to that person if an order for possession had been made on either of those grounds.

(4) In section 87(4) (general interpretation), in subsection (1), at the appropriate places in alphabetical order, insert—

introductory standard contract” has the same meaning as in the Renting Homes (Wales) Act 2016 (anaw 1) (see section 16 of that Act);;

secure contract” has the same meaning as in the Renting Homes (Wales) Act 2016 (see section 8 of that Act);.
